Interactive marketing is a strategy that engages customers directly, encouraging them to participate in the marketing process. It goes beyond one-way communication, allowing for a two-way exchange between the brand and the consumer. Here are some benefits of interactive marketing:
- Engagement: Interactive marketing captures the audience’s attention and encourages active participation, leading to higher engagement levels.
- Personification: It enables personalised interactions, tailoring content and experiences based on individual preferences and behaviours.
- Data Collection: Interactive campaigns provide valuable data about customer preferences, behaviour, and demographics, aiding in better targeting and decision-making.
- Brand Loyalty: Engaging customers in a meaningful way fosters a sense of connection and loyalty to the brand.
- Real-time Feedback: Immediate feedback from interactive campaigns allows businesses to make prompt adjustments and improvements.
- Viral Potential: Interactive content is often shareable, increasing its potential to go viral and reach a wider audience.
- Memorability: Participation in interactive experiences creates memorable moments, making the brand more likely to stick in the customer’s mind.
- Measurable Results: The effectiveness of interactive marketing campaigns can be measured through metrics such as click-through rates, conversion rates, and social shares.
- Adaptability: Interactive strategies can be adapted to various channels and devices, providing a versatile approach to marketing.
- Enhanced Customer Experience: By involving customers in the marketing process, businesses can create more enjoyable and memorable experiences, enhancing overall customer satisfaction.
